Miss Madeline Pattern

Big girl

Sizes 5 - 10 years

 

This is sweet little peasant style dress with options for a contrasting waistband or apron. There are instructions for making an apron or you can use up your stash of vintage hankies or tea towels! What a beautiful way to use Grandmas hankies!

 

Free embroidery design included!

Fabric requirements are based on 45” wide fabric.

 

Size

5

6

7

8

10

Chest

22”

23”

24”

25”

26-27”

Main Fabric

1 ¼ yd

1 ¼ yd

1 ¼ yd

1 1/2 yd

1 1/2 yd

Waistband Fabric (View A)

1/8 yd

1/8 yd

1/8 yd

1/8 yd

1/8 yd

Main Apron Fabric (View B)

½ yd

½ yd

½ yd

½ yd

½ yd

 

Waistband and Apron Edge( View B)

3/8 yd

3/8 yd

3/8 yd

3/8 yd

3/8 yd

 

 Notions: Thread, 1/4" elastic, 1/2" elastic.

 

Suggested fabrics: Cotton, pique, silk, linen, or calico.
